Talia Toeg is an Israeli artist born in 1965. She began painting at a very young age, graduating in art studies from the University of Haifa, where she studied with painters Tsibi Geva and Avner Katz, among others. She also studied at the Hatachana Studio with painter David Nipo. Toeg's works are mainly on the subject of landscapes in an impressionistic style bordering on the abstract.
Toeg's works have been exhibited in several solo and group exhibitions in Israel
